BACKGROUND: The latest edition of DSM (DSM-5) introduced important revisions to PTSD symptomatological criteria, such as a four-factor model and the inclusion of new symptoms. To date, only a few studies have investigated the impact that the proposed DSM-5 criteria will have on prevalence rates of PTSD. METHODS: An overall sample of 512 adolescents who survived the L'Aquila 2009 earthquake and were previously investigated for the presence of full and partial PTSD, using DSM-IV-TR criteria, were reassessed according to DSM-5 criteria. All subjects completed the Trauma and Loss Spectrum-Self Report (TALS-SR). RESULTS: A DSM-5 PTSD diagnosis emerged in 39.8% of subjects, with a significant difference between the two sexes (p<0.001), and an overall 87.1% consistency with DSM-IV-TR. Most of the inconsistent diagnoses that fulfilled DSM-IV-TR criteria but not DSM-5 criteria can be attributed to the subjects not fulfilling the new criterion C (active avoidance). Each DSM-5 symptom was more highly correlated with its corresponding symptom cluster than with other symptom clusters, but two of the new symptoms showed moderate to weak item-cluster correlations. Among DSM-5 PTSD cases: 7 (3.4%) endorsed symptom D3; 151 (74%) D4; 28 (13.7%) both D3 and D4; 75 (36.8%) E2. LIMITATIONS: The use of a self-report instrument; no information on comorbidity; homogeneity of study sample; lack of assessment on functional impairment; the rates of DSM-IV-TR qualified PTSD in the sample was only 37.5%. CONCLUSIONS: This study provides an inside look at the empirical performance of the DSM-5 PTSD criteria in a population exposed to a natural disaster, which suggests the need for replication in larger epidemiological samples.

The adsorption of humic acid on crosslinked chitosan-epichlorohydrin (chitosan-ECH) beads was investigated. Chitosan-ECH beads were characterized by Fourier transform infrared spectroscopy (FTIR), surface area and pore size analyses, and scanning electron microscopy (SEM). Batch adsorption experiments were carried out and optimum humic acid adsorption on chitosan-ECH beads occurred at pH 6.0, agitation rate of 300 rpm and contact time of 50 min. Adsorption equilibrium isotherms were analyzed by Langmuir and Freundlich models. Freundlich model was found to show the best fit for experimental data while the maximum adsorption capacity determined from Langmuir model was 44.84 mg g(-1). The adsorption of humic acid on chitosan-ECH beads was best described with pseudo-first-order kinetic model. For desorption study, more than 60% of humic acid could be desorbed from the adsorbent using 1.0M HCl for 180 min.
